Abstract
In a power transmitter device, a power transmitter side active electrode and a power transmitter side passive electrode are formed. In a power receiver device, a power receiver side active electrode and a power receiver side passive electrode are formed. The power transmitter side active electrode is rectangle that is shorter in a first direction and longer in a second direction. The power receiver side active electrode is rectangle that is longer in the first direction and shorter in the second direction. The power transmitter side active electrode and the power receiver side active electrode are formed so as that lengths of overlapping area in the first and second directions do not change in a placement receivable area on the power transmitter device, within which the power receiver device is allowed to be displaced.
